Output 594e3322f75127a163d756e5b851c2403366deaa91b393f19438ddc34f654454:0

value
139480000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3f9ee8533d1dc82a2c84d16a19eb9db940eff62 OP_EQUALVERIFY OP_CHECKSIG
address
1HQdMu5qctoqLhNcticPtQA8akqT2Kbk16
transaction
594e3322f75127a163d756e5b851c2403366deaa91b393f19438ddc34f654454
spent
true